Two former CEOs of Atlanta-based Grady Memorial Hospital are battling in court. Pamela Stephenson replaced Otis Story as CEO in early 2008, and Stephenson was head of the Grady board that ousted him. Story felt slighted by the dismissal and, in a lawsuit filed against the board and Stephenson, accused her of engineering his dismissal so she could grab his  job. In court papers filed June 15, Stephenson asserted that Story slandered her by telling others that she was a sexually available woman whom he could have slept with.
